Everything about Mobile Development Freelance
Xcode includes intuitive style applications which make it quick to develop interfaces with SwiftUI. As you work in the look canvas, everything you edit is totally in sync Along with the code inside the adjoining editor.
As soon as that’s carried out, Xcode will develop the new project for you, then open up ContentView.swift for enhancing. This is when we’ll publish all our code, and you also’ll see some default SwiftUI code in there for us.
The design canvas the thing is isn’t just an approximation of the person interface — it’s your live app. And Xcode can swap edited code directly with your live app working with dynamic replacement.
Within this tutorial you’re planning to use Swift and SwiftUI to create a little application to propose enjoyment new activities to users. Along the way in which you’ll satisfy numerous of The fundamental elements of a SwiftUI app, together with text, photos, buttons, shapes, stacks, and program state.
To get rolling, you’ll need to download Xcode from your Mac Application Retail outlet. It’s free, and comes with Swift and all the other tools you'll want to abide by this tutorial.
Previews. Now you can produce one particular or lots of previews of any SwiftUI sights to obtain sample info, and configure Practically just about anything your consumers may possibly see, like massive fonts, localizations, or Darkish Manner. Previews may display your UI in almost any device and any orientation.
And fourth, it would be awesome In case the change concerning pursuits was smoother, which we are able to do by animating the improve. In SwiftUI, That is performed by wrapping modifications we wish to animate using a simply call for the withAnimation() functionality, such as this:
Nevertheless, That which you see in Xcode’s preview probably won’t match Whatever you were being anticipating: you’ll see exactly the same icon as ahead of, but no textual content. What presents?
This declarative fashion even applies to complicated concepts like animation. Easily increase animation to Just about any Management and pick a collection of Completely ready-to-use outcomes with just a few lines of code.
To generate that happen, we have to begin by defining some additional system point out inside our look at. This would be the identifier for our inner VStack, and since it'll adjust as our program runs we’ll use @Condition. Add this house future to selected:
That should result in our button push to move amongst activities with a mild fade. If you want, it is possible to customise that animation by passing the animation you need to the withAnimation() simply call, like this:
We’ll also article backlinks in this article on Swift.org to Various other popular tutorials – we’re a huge and welcoming Group, and we’re glad to Have you ever sign up for!
That partly fixes our code, but Xcode will continue to be exhibiting an mistake. best website The trouble now is the fact SwiftUI doesn’t like us shifting our plan’s point out appropriate inside our watch structs with no warning – it desires us to mark many of the mutable condition beforehand, so it is aware to watch for improvements.
We get to select, but I do think listed best website here a vertical structure will search better. In SwiftUI we get that by using a new view variety called VStack, and that is placed close to